4 Subject: [PATCH 168/174] spidev: fix hang when transfer_one_message fails
6 commit e120cc0dcf2880a4c5c0a6cb27b655600a1cfa1d upstream.
8 This corrects a problem in spi_pump_messages() that leads to an spi
9 message hanging forever when a call to transfer_one_message() fails.
10 This failure occurs in my MCP2210 driver when the cs_change bit is set
11 on the last transfer in a message, an operation which the hardware does
15 Since the transfer_one_message() returns an int, we must presume that it
16 may fail. If transfer_one_message() should never fail, it should return
17 void. Thus, calls to transfer_one_message() should properly manage a
